Tar and gravel roof services encompass a range of maintenance, repair, and installation tasks aimed at ensuring the durability and performance of this traditional roofing system. These services often involve inspecting the roof for signs of wear or damage, replacing or repairing gravel surfaces, and applying new layers of tar to seal leaks or weak spots. Professionals may also perform coating or patching work to extend the lifespan of the roof, helping to prevent issues before they develop into more costly problems.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help preserve the integrity of the roof and protect the underlying structure from water intrusion and weather-related damage.
One of the primary issues addressed by tar and gravel roof services is the deterioration caused by exposure to the elements. Over time, gravel surfaces can become loose or displaced, and the tar layers may crack or degrade, leading to leaks or reduced insulation. These services help identify and remedy such problems through patching, resealing, or replacing damaged sections. Regular inspections and repairs can also prevent more extensive damage, such as structural rot or mold growth, which can compromise the safety and stability of the building.
Tar and gravel roofing is commonly used on commercial properties, industrial facilities, and some residential buildings with flat or low-slope roofs. These roofs are valued for their durability, affordability, and ease of maintenance. Commercial warehouses, office buildings, and multi-family housing often feature tar and gravel roofs due to their capacity to withstand heavy foot traffic and harsh weather conditions. Additionally, property owners seeking a cost-effective roofing solution that provides reliable protection may opt for this type of roofing system, making it a practical choice for various property types.

What is a tar and gravel roof? A tar and gravel roof is a flat roofing system that uses asphalt-based materials combined with a layer of gravel or stone for protection and durability.
How often should a tar and gravel ro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year to identify potential issues before they develop into costly repairs.
What signs indicate a need for repairs on a tar and gravel roof? Common signs include pooling water, cracked or blistered surface, exposed gravel, or leaks inside the building.
Can a tar and gravel roof be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many repairs are possible to extend the roof's lifespan, but a professional assessment can determine if replacement is necessary.
What maintenance is recommended for a tar and gravel roof? Routine cleaning to remove debris, inspecting for damage, and addressing minor issues promptly can help maintain the roof's integrity.
